Device Authority And Cryptosoft Announce Strategic Partnership
[October 13, 2015]

Device Authority And Cryptosoft Announce Strategic Partnership


Device Authority, an industry leader in cyber security, has announced a strategic partnership with Cryptosoft, the leader in policy driven authentication and encryption services for connected IoT and M2M devices. Cryptosoft will offer Device Authority’s D-FACTOR™ M2M authentication to provide device-based security and device-derived cryptography for its IoT data security technology platform. This integration with Device Authority technology further strengthens Cryptosoft’s commitment to deliver IoT native data centric security methods to the marketplace.



"Through this partnership we have a unique ability to offer a scalable, certificate-less, approach to securing information assets at a data level for the IoT ecosystem. What truly sets us apart now is our ability to deliver this with or without the use of a traditional PKI", says Jon Penney, Cryptosoft CTO and founder.

“I’m very excited about what this partnership represents for the security of IoT data and applications,” says Talbot Harty, CEO of Device Authority. “The combination of our technology provides a highly differentiated set of advanced security capabilities and operational benefits for large-scale IoT deployment and management, including device authentication, data encryption, and policy-based device registration and authorization control.” The partnership with Cryptosoft advances Device Authority’s market strategy to partner with leading IoT gateway and platform solution providers to provide device-driven trust and scalable security for the Internet of Things.
